Package: rescue-mode
Version: 1.15
Severity: minor
While testing rescue-mode, I noticed that the root filesystem (ext3)
was mounted as ext2 by the following log line:
kernel: EXT2-fs warning (device hda6) ext2_fill_super: mounting ext3
filesystem as ext2
Maybe we need to explicitely try ext3 before relying on autodection.
Or remove the ext2 module from the list of manually loaded modules…
